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,631 in Harrisburg, PA versus $2,877 in Williamsburg, VA.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,737 in Harrisburg, PA versus $4,185 in Williamsburg, VA.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,844 in Harrisburg, PA versus $5,494 in Williamsburg, VA.

Living in Harrisburg, PA costs roughly 9% less than in Williamsburg, VA,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

Both cities are pricier than the global median: Harrisburg, PA 97% above, Williamsburg, VA 115% above.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,536 in Harrisburg, PA and $2,445 in Williamsburg, VA.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Williamsburg, VA pays 3%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$66.0 in Harrisburg, PA vs $81.0 in Williamsburg, VA. Groceries flip the comparison at $460 vs $360, with Williamsburg, VA cheaper for home cooking.
